Why waterproof matters on course
Weather can shift quickly on a round, and staying dry is more than a matter of comfort; it affects grip, stability, and swing tempo. Waterproof features often combine waterproof uppers with moisture-wicking linings to keep feet dry while preventing overheating. A well-designed pair should also shed water efficiently, preventing buildup that could weigh you down or distract your mental focus during critical shots. The right kit helps maintain confidence under pressure.
Support and durability for serious players
Durability is essential for golfers who walk long courses and negotiate uneven terrain. Look for reinforced toe caps, robust midsole padding, and reliable outsole lug patterns that grip wet and muddy surfaces. A secure lacing system, along with a snug heel cup, guarantees consistent stability across diverse lies. Longevity comes from quality materials and thoughtful construction that withstand year-round play, preserving performance beyond a single season.
Practical tips for choosing the right pair
Start with a precise fit, ensuring there is minimal movement inside the shoe while you walk. Consider cushioning that supports the arch without compromising energy transfer during the swing. Water resistance should be proven in real-world conditions, not just marketing claims, so read independent reviews and try on multiple sizes. Pairing with the right socks can also enhance warmth and moisture management during cooler rounds.
